Definition

  1. 1
    Nominativ Singular Maskulinum der starken Deklination des Positivs des Adjektivs stehend
  2. 2
    Genitiv Singular Femininum der starken Deklination des Positivs des Adjektivs stehend
  3. 3
    Dativ Singular Femininum der starken Deklination des Positivs des Adjektivs stehend
  4. 4
    Genitiv Plural alle Genera der starken Deklination des Positivs des Adjektivs stehend
  5. 5
    Nominativ Singular Maskulinum der gemischten Deklination des Positivs des Adjektivs stehend
